php連接雲資料庫
PHP鏈接資料庫有幾種方式
mysqli:
<?php
$servername="localhost";
$username="username";
$password="password";
//創建連接
$conn=newmysqli($servername,$username,$password);
//檢測連接
if($conn->connect_error){
die("連接失敗:".$conn->connect_error);
}
echo"連接成功";
?>
也可以使用PDO進行鏈接,前提是你必須在php.ini中開啟PDO:
<?php
$servername="localhost";
$username="username";
$password="password";
try{
$conn=newPDO("mysql:host=$servername;dbname=myDB",$username,$password);
echo"連接成功";
}
catch(PDOException$e)
{
echo$e->getMessage();
}
?>
建議使用PDO,功能更加強大,兼容各種資料庫
❷ 如何遠程使用PHP控制小鳥雲雲主機的MYSQL
對於PHP入門用戶來說,我們只要掌握基本的資料庫寫入、讀取、編輯、刪除等基本的操作就算入門,也可以寫出簡單的程序出來,比如留言本、新聞文章系統等等。 在整個過程中,MySQL資料庫的連接也是比較重要的,可以使用多種方法進行連接,對於新手來說我們就不要去分析哪種方式對於系統資源的優化程度,我們先能連接上就行。
這里,整理幾種常用的PHP連接MySQL資料庫的方法。
常用普通方法
$mysql_server="localhost";
$mysql_username="資料庫用戶名";
$mysql_password="資料庫密碼";
$mysql_database="資料庫名";
//建立資料庫鏈接
$conn = mysql_connect($mysql_server,$mysql_username,$mysql_password) or die("資料庫鏈接錯誤");
//選擇某個資料庫
mysql_select_db($mysql_database,$conn);
mysql_query("set names 'utf8'");
//執行MySQL語句
$result=mysql_query("SELECT id,name FROM 資料庫表");
//提取數據
$row=mysql_fetch_row($result);
在提取數據的時候,我們使用mysql_fetch_row,還可以使用mysql_fetch_assoc和mysql_fetch_array,具體的我們參考手冊。
面向對象方法
$db=new mysqli($dbhost,$username,$userpass,$dbdatabase);
if(mysqli_connect_error()){
echo 'Could not connect to database.';
exit;
}
$result=$db->query("SELECT id,name FROM user");
$row=$result->fetch_row();
PDO方法
$dsn='mysql:host='.$dbhost.';dbname='.$dbdatabase.';'
$dbh=new PDO($dsn,$username,$userpass);
$stmt=$dbh->query('SELECT id,name FROM user');
$row=$stmt->fetch();
以上是常用的3種PHP連接MySQL資料庫的方法,我們可以嘗試使用,一般我們用第一種比較多。
❸ PHP如何配置TP框架,連接騰訊雲雲資料庫
需要你在阿里雲選擇一款伺服器配置,然後用第三方一鍵php包的配置,伺服器配置出可視化php環境界面,上傳程序,安裝網站,添加內容。
下載TP5完整版(初學者學慣用的)
解壓到本地的開發環境中,默認的入口文件是public,訪問public會看到TP5成功頁面。
開發一個項目的時候,通常分為前台和後台,前台一般放在index模塊中,後台一般放在admin模塊中。所以你想鏈接資料庫,就去 admin文件夾修改 database.php 連接資料庫時候讀取的文件,就可以了。
TP框架都這么操作出來的,這是個思路,因為這方面內容較多,這里也寫不開那麼多內容,在這留言或到咱們的blog找相關內容,可以幫助入門。
❹ hdphp框架怎麼連接新浪雲資料庫
使用新浪SAE架構搭建自己的網站。將自己在本地編寫的PHP程序上傳到SAE上。如果要正常使用需要鏈接MySQL資料庫(如果你的網站使用了MySQL資料庫服務)。
新浪SAE提供了對PHP訪問MySQL的程序支持。所以這個過程要實現起來並不困難。只需要修改用戶名和密碼。
創建完應用後,MySQL資料庫仍然是不可用的。首先要點擊右側列表的MySQL(如下圖紅圈處)進行初始化。初始化完成後可以訪問mysql,否則連接資料庫則會出現 mysql_connect() 的 access deny 的錯誤。
接下來,看下代碼是如何修改的。
1、本地訪問的代碼
<?php
$con =
mysql_connect("localhost","root","123"); if(!$con) //判斷是否鏈接成功 {
die('could not connect:'.mysql_error()); }
mysql_select_db("weibo",$con); //選擇名稱為「weibo」的database
?>
//mysql_connect() 連接資料庫函數
❺ 阿里雲php連接資料庫建表,是這樣寫的嗎
提示的錯誤信息是什麼?
CREATE,不是CREAT。mima varchar(19)後面不要加逗號,因為後面沒有子句了。
然後檢查資料庫伺服器是不是和站點伺服器為同一地址,否則不能用localhost。然後檢查用戶名密碼是否正確。
另外mysql_connect的方法早就過時了,php7以後已經徹底廢除了,你看下你的php版本。並建議你也不要再使用mysql擴展,改用mysqli或pdo擴展。
❻ phpstorm怎麼連接阿里雲的mysql
phpstorm怎麼連接阿里雲的mysql
打開phpstorm,打開Database窗口,如下圖:
配置mysql連接,如下圖:
填寫mysql地址,用戶名,密碼,如果沒有安裝驅動,要先安裝驅動
測試資料庫能否連接成功:
保存配置,保存時,會提示設置密碼:
讀取資料庫表,及根據條件查詢修改:
❼ 新浪雲資料庫Php連接
我看你這個是不知道連接參數的意思吧?
define('DB_HOST', 'localhost');
define('DB_USER', 'root'); //數據賬號
define('DB_PWD', 'root'); //密碼
define('DB_NAME', 'demo'); //資料庫名稱
DB_HOST 就是資料庫伺服器ip:這個就是你新浪雲資料庫的IP;
DB_USER這個就是你新浪雲資料庫的資料庫用戶名;
DB_PWD這個就是你新浪雲資料庫的資料庫用戶密碼;
DB_NAME:這個就是你新浪雲資料庫的資料庫名;
如果是資料庫遷移,那麼你要把目前的資料庫遷移到新浪雲上邊,建立同樣的資料庫,數據表;
如果數據在新浪雲上已經有了,你這邊只需要改了這個配置為新浪雲給你的連接信息就可以了;
如果你新浪雲上沒有布置環境,那麼你要在新浪雲上安裝mysql,以及配置對應資料庫IP的開放埠及許可權;
❽ 我在新浪雲平台上安裝一個PHP網站,怎麼連接平台的資料庫名和資料庫密碼呢
我看你這個是不知道連接參數的意思吧?
define('db_host',
'localhost');
define('db_user',
'root');
//數據賬號
define('db_pwd',
'root');
//密碼
define('db_name',
'demo');
//資料庫名稱
db_host
就是資料庫伺服器ip:這個就是你新浪雲資料庫的ip;
db_user 這個就是你新浪雲資料庫的資料庫用戶名;
db_pwd 這個就是你新浪雲資料庫的資料庫用戶密碼;
db_name:這個就是你新浪雲資料庫的資料庫名;
1.
如果是資料庫遷移,那麼你要把目前的資料庫遷移到新浪雲上邊,建立同樣的資料庫,數據表;
2.
如果數據在新浪雲上已經有了,你這邊只需要改了這個配置為新浪雲給你的連接信息就可以了;
3.
如果你新浪雲上沒有布置環境,那麼你要在新浪雲上安裝mysql,以及配置對應資料庫ip的開放埠及許可權;